新手上路!! main.c文件中,尝试一直发送数据,同时串口一直接收数据; 在PC端使用串口工具,通过PL2303串口转换与STM32F429 PA9/10连接, 调试模式下,始终无法接收到PC端发过来的数据; 求高手指点!! uint8_t i=0xAA; uint8_t TxData[8]= {0x48,0x48,0x48,0x48,0x48,0x48,0x48,0x48}; while (1) { /* USER CODE END WHILE */ HAL_UART_Transmit(&huart1, TxData,8,10); HAL_Delay(1000); HAL_UART_Receive_IT(&huart1, RxData,8); //无法接收到数据; HAL_Delay(1000); /* USER CODE BEGIN 3 */ } /* USER CODE END 3 */ } 串口接收回调函数: void HAL_UART_RxCpltCallback(UART_HandleTypeDef *UartHandle) { HAL_UART_Transmit(&huart1,RxData,8,10);//无法接收到数据; } |
STM32F107+LWIP---如何检查tcp通讯断开?并重新连接
有没有用过数字式mems麦克风的,想问下SPI通讯的问题
stm32f103 CAN通讯多帧发送问题?
STM32F107作为USB主机模拟串口通讯不成功(采用PL2303芯片)
STM32F103C8 LIN通讯例程
求助,丐版J-Link通讯不上
ethernet可以与ethercat通讯吗?
LIS3DH SPI 通讯问题
STM32F373 CAN通讯问题CAN_FLAG_LEC
请教高手看看,STM32F1的多机通讯,地址匹配唤醒问题
大神,有程序范例的话,同步一份学习了!!
哪里下载HAL库??
没有解决,
目前使用接收单字节命令,进行控制
我用中断的话可以10个字节的传送
void HAL_UART_RxCpltCallback(UART_HandleTypeDef *UartHandle)
{
HAL_UART_Transmit(&huart1,table1,10,10);
HAL_UART_Receive_IT(&huart1,table1,10);
}
//}
我是计划在主程序中评定收到的一串字符,然后进行对应功能的程序执行;
在callback事件中进行字符串接收
结果,失败了;